The State of Haryana v/s Jai Singh & Others…

Haryana loses land battle: unused ‘Bachat’ land stays with farmers, not state. The Supreme Court upheld the High Court’s ruling that unutilized bachat land reserved during consolidation does not vest in the State or Gram Panchayat. Such land must revert to the original landowners, as its reservation without specific common use violates constitutional protections under

Kuldeep v/s State OF Uttarakhand CRLA FBA 1621/25 15/09/25…

Sections 420 and 120B IPC Bail application – Applicant accused of cheating and criminal conspiracy – Applicant in judicial custody – Co-accused granted bail – Charge-sheet already filed – Court held that there was no reason to keep the applicant behind bars for an indefinite period – Bail granted to the applicant on personal bond

Jyoti v/s Vishnu CA 11768/25 11/09/25…

SUPREME COURT OF INDIA Landlord-tenant relationship — Bona fide need — Landlord seeking eviction for expanding family business — Tenant disputing ownership based on Will – Court held that the Will probated establishes legal sanctity -Tenant’s challenge to ownership unsustainable after decades of tenancy and rent payment.
